C#でExcelメタデータを編集する
C#
と IronXL
を使用してプログラムで Excel メタデータを編集することで、開発者は手動での操作を介さずに、著者、タイトル、主題、またはカスタムメタデータフィールドなどのワークブックプロパティをシームレスに更新または操作できます。 この機能は、自動ワークフロー、大規模なデータ処理、またはSQLデータベースなどの他のシステムとの統合を伴うシナリオにおいて特に有益です。
IronXLは、XLSX、XLS、CSVなどの一般的なExcel形式をサポートすることで、このプロセスを効率化します。この機能により、報告、監査、またはメタデータ駆動型アプリケーションを扱うチームの手動作業が最小限に抑えられ、正確性が保証されます。 それは、Excelファイルとバックエンドシステムの統合を簡素化し、実際のエンタープライズ環境で効果的にスケールする動的でメタデータ中心のソリューションを可能にします。
C#でExcelメタデータを編集する5つのステップ
var workBook = WorkBook.Load("sample.xlsx");
- workBook.Metadata.Title = "更新されたタイトル";
workBook.Metadata.Author = "John Doe";
workBook.Metadata.Subject = "財務報告書";
- workBook.SaveAs("UpdatedSample.xlsx");
上記のコードは、C#でIronXLを使用してExcelファイルのメタデータを変更する方法を示しています。 最初のステップは、WorkBook.Load
メソッドを使用してExcelファイルsample.xlsx
をWorkBook
オブジェクトにロードすることです。 これにより、title
、author
、subject
などのプロパティを含む可能性があるワークブックのメタデータにアクセスできます。 これらのプロパティは、通常、ファイルを整理および分類するために使用され、更新された情報や関連情報を反映するようにプログラムで変更することができます。
ブックがロードされると、WorkBookオブジェクトのMetadataプロパティにアクセスして、Title
、Author
、Subject
などの特定のメタデータフィールドを更新します。 必要な変更を加えた後、SaveAs
メソッドを使用して修正されたワークブックを新しいファイル UpdatedSample.xlsx
として保存し、更新されたメタデータが保存されるようにします。 このメソッドを使用すると、開発者は複数のExcelファイルのメタデータを編集および保存するプロセスを自動化できます。これは、データ処理およびレポーティングのワークフローで特に役立ちます。
クリックして、例、サンプルコード、およびファイルを含むハウツーガイドをご覧ください。